How can companies effectively measure the success of their efforts in fostering a customer-oriented culture within their organization, and what strategies can they implement to continuously improve and maintain high levels of employee engagement and commitment in this area?
Companies can measure the success of fostering a customer-oriented culture by tracking customer satisfaction scores, repeat business rates, and customer loyalty metrics. To continuously improve and maintain high levels of employee engagement and commitment in this area, companies can implement regular training on customer service best practices, provide recognition and rewards for employees who demonstrate customer-centric behaviors, and solicit feedback from employees on ways to enhance the customer experience. Additionally, creating a culture of open communication and transparency can help employees feel valued and engaged in delivering exceptional customer service.
